Lucknow Super Giants¡¯ rising spinner Digvesh Rathi has recently made headlines, not just for his performance, but for disciplinary issues on the field. The Indian Premier League (IPL) has taken strict action against the youngster, fining him 50% of his match fee and suspending him for one game due to repeated code of conduct breaches.

Digvesh Rathi has been fined multiple times during IPL 2025 for his aggressive celebrations. The most recent incident occurred during the match between Lucknow Super Giants (LSG) and Sunrisers Hyderabad, where Rathi dismissed Abhishek Sharma and performed his controversial "notebook celebration" once again.
This on-field action didn¡¯t sit well with the umpires or players. Abhishek Sharma confronted Rathi, leading to a heated exchange that required intervention from umpires, teammates, and even Rishabh Pant. This was Rathi¡¯s third offence under Article 2.5 of the IPL Code of Conduct, earning him a one-match suspension and a 50% match fee fine.
With each IPL match fetching him a salary of Rs 7.5 lakh, fines have significantly cut into his income this season, according to TOI. Despite being new to the league, Rathi¡¯s antics have made him a well-known name, though not always for the right reasons.
First fine: During the match against Punjab Kings on April 1, Digvesh Rathi was fined 25% of his match fee (Rs 1,87,500) for mocking batsman Priyansh Arya with a notebook-style celebration.
Second fine: On April 4, Rathi repeated the same gesture after dismissing Naman Dhir in a game against the Mumbai Indians. This time, the IPL fined him 50% of his match fee (Rs 3,75,000).
Third fine: Against Sunrisers Hyderabad, he again performed the celebration after dismissing Abhishek Sharma, which led to another 50% fine and a suspension.
In total, Digvesh Rathi has been fined Rs 9,37,500 for his on-field behaviour in IPL 2025 so far.
Digvesh Rathi's IPL price for 2025 was Rs 30 lakh. He was picked by Lucknow Super Giants at his base price during the IPL 2025 Super Auction.
Digvesh Rathi¡¯s net worth is estimated to be around Rs 1 crore, according to TV9 Bharatvarsh. His earnings mostly come from IPL contracts and domestic cricket appearances. With his rising fame (and fines), Rathi has become one of the most talked-about young cricketers in India.
Born on 15 December 1999, Digvesh Singh Rathi plays for Delhi in domestic cricket. He made his T20 debut on 29 November 2024 in the Syed Mushtaq Ali Trophy. Just months later, he was signed by LSG for the IPL 2025 season.
In his IPL debut, Rathi made an instant impact by dismissing Delhi Capitals' captain Axar Patel with his third ball ¡ª a dream start for any bowler. However, his controversial celebrations have overshadowed his early success.
With a match suspension now in place, Digvesh Rathi will miss LSG¡¯s upcoming clash against the Gujarat Titans. The spinner currently has five demerit points, and any further misconduct could lead to stricter punishment.
